在数字化转型的浪潮下,云原生技术逐渐成为企业提升竞争力的关键。云原生可观测性作为云原生技术的重要组成部分,能够帮助企业实时监控、分析和管理应用性能,从而实现投资回报率最大化。本文将从云原生可观测性的成本效益出发,探讨如何实现投资回报率最大化。
一、云原生可观测性的定义与价值
云原生可观测性是指通过收集、存储、分析和可视化数据,实现对云原生应用、服务和基础设施的实时监控。它包括以下几个方面:
指标收集:实时收集应用、服务和基础设施的运行指标,如CPU、内存、网络、磁盘等。
日志收集:收集应用、服务和基础设施的日志信息,便于问题定位和故障排查。
事件追踪:实时追踪应用、服务和基础设施中的事件,如请求、错误、告警等。
监控可视化:将收集到的数据通过图表、报表等形式进行可视化展示,便于用户直观了解系统运行状况。
云原生可观测性为企业带来的价值主要体现在以下几个方面:
提高系统稳定性:通过实时监控,及时发现并解决潜在问题,降低系统故障率。
优化资源利用:合理分配资源,提高资源利用率,降低运维成本。
提升开发效率:便于快速定位问题,缩短故障修复时间,提高开发效率。
保障业务连续性:在系统出现故障时,及时采取应对措施,保障业务连续性。
二、云原生可观测性的成本效益分析
- 成本分析
(1)硬件成本:云原生可观测性主要依赖虚拟化、容器等技术,硬件成本相对较低。
(2)软件成本:云原生可观测性需要部署相应的监控工具和平台,软件成本包括购买许可证、维护和升级等。
(3)人力成本:云原生可观测性需要专业的运维人员负责部署、配置、监控和分析等工作。
- 效益分析
(1)降低故障率:通过实时监控,及时发现并解决潜在问题,降低系统故障率。
(2)提高资源利用率:合理分配资源,降低运维成本。
(3)提升开发效率:缩短故障修复时间,提高开发效率。
(4)保障业务连续性:在系统出现故障时,及时采取应对措施,保障业务连续性。
三、实现投资回报率最大化的策略
选择合适的监控工具和平台:根据企业实际需求,选择性能稳定、功能完善的监控工具和平台,降低软件成本。
精简监控指标:针对核心业务指标进行监控,避免过度监控,降低人力成本。
优化资源配置:合理分配资源,提高资源利用率,降低运维成本。
培养专业人才:加强运维人员的培训,提高其专业技能,降低人力成本。
实施自动化运维:通过自动化工具,实现监控、报警、故障排查等自动化操作,降低人力成本。
总之,云原生可观测性在提高企业系统稳定性、优化资源利用、提升开发效率、保障业务连续性等方面具有显著的价值。通过合理选择监控工具、优化资源配置、培养专业人才等策略,企业可以实现投资回报率最大化。在数字化转型的道路上,云原生可观测性将成为企业提升竞争力的关键因素。